Stop 2: Piazza del Plebiscito
Next, you’ll cruise to Piazza del Plebiscito, Naples’ largest and most iconic square. Here, the Royal Palace and San Carlo Theater dominate the scene, both rich in history. The Galleria Umberto I nearby adds an architectural flourish and is perfect for a quick photo or a cozy coffee break.
Travelers have said they appreciated being able to stop and explore from outside, especially since the square is accessible in a wheelchair. The vibrant atmosphere is palpable, whether you’re gazing at the historic buildings or enjoying the local street performers.
Stop 3: Piazza del Gesù Nuovo and the Historic Center
The final stop takes you into the heart of Naples’ UNESCO World Heritage site, with its narrow streets, historic basilicas, and lively atmosphere. The Spaccanapoli, a famed street slicing through the old city, showcases the city’s layered past and lively street life.
